The Ballroom Cabaret at The Sheldon Concert Hall

The Sheldon Concert Hall’s Ballroom sits directly above the buildings main concert hall and is original to the building which was opened in 1912. It is regularly used as a sophisticated setting for galas, receptions and other special events. 

When the Cabaret Project and our two education programs The St. Louis Cabaret Conference and Sing Center Stage perform there the space is transformed into The Ballroom Cabaret, an elegant 160 seat table and chairs listening room. As the photos below show, the transformation includes a beautiful red theater curtain, chandelier, round top table and chairs, table lamps and a 8 inch high stage platform.  All this is made possible with support from The Gateway Foundation.
